Transaction 4a1c66c324de9569e2e60c1b41579e299604bb4a58a269efed07a503f254c49e

1 Input
2 Outputs
  • 4a1c66c324de9569e2e60c1b41579e299604bb4a58a269efed07a503f254c49e:0
  • value  2000000
    address  13Usatpm5SUNHeaTFDgoU2wHpWjXRynY4v
  • 4a1c66c324de9569e2e60c1b41579e299604bb4a58a269efed07a503f254c49e:1
  • value  35289917
    address  19wrriQfZEGzX4dELQwtiACD6mptXK93L9